    Best Commercial Paint Finishes for High Traffic Areas

    Satin Finish

    • The best paint for high-traffic areas balancing appearance and performance.
    • Smooth, soft sheen hides imperfections while remaining washable.
    • Applications: Office suites, hallways, multi-family common areas, healthcare and hospitality spaces.
    • Approved Products: a durable satin interior coating, a scuff-resistant satin coating

    Eggshell

    • Warm, inviting look with moderate cleanability.
    • Ideal for low-contact, decorative spaces like conference rooms or executive offices.

    Matte and Flat

    • Used sparingly for feature walls where a non-reflective finish is desired.
    • Not recommended for corridors, lobbies, or other high-traffic areas.

    Why Application Standards Matter

    Even the most durable paint can underperform if it's not applied correctly. Our team adheres to clearly defined protocols:

    • Thorough surface preparation – Every surface is cleaned, patched, sanded, and primed.
    • Environmental controls – We monitor temperature and humidity for ideal conditions.
    • Film thickness verification – We measure both wet and dry film thickness.
    • Two-stage inspections – Every project is reviewed before turnover.
